On Tue, 11 Mar 2008, Scott Marlowe wrote:

> That kind of change does NOT get into production versions of
> postgresql.  With a yearly release schedule, postgresql doesn't have
> to put dodgy performance updates in a production release.

This is worth expanding on:  PostgreSQL doesn't put *any* feature changes
in a production release.  Once it's a stable release, only bug fixes are
applied.  Any other way is madness.
